04 1. Introduction: Revealing an ''Eleusinian Mystery'' 2. ''Men of Known and Approved Fidelity'': The Development of the Bow Street System 3. ''If the Gentleman Writes, the Gentleman Pays'': The Employers of Principal Officers 4. ''Contending with Desperate Characters'': The Types of Crimes Investigated by Principal Officers 5. ''Police Officers for the Country at Large'': The Nationwide Role of the Principal Officers, 6. ''Domiciliary Visits, Spies, and all the rest of Fouche''s Contrivances'': Six Case Studies of Provincial Investigations by Principal Officers 7. '' More Expert in Tracing and Detecting Crime'': The Post-1829 Situation 8 . ''Rescuing from an Historical Cul-de-sac'': The Legacy of the Bow Street Principal Officers. References
